Output e53d59c6f194e306dfb55bbbe97e14335829e6281b9b343e10ad8665c22f582b:3

value
805332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a43a315d124dc4697956e91e6f68ef323c60e1b OP_EQUAL
address
32dHhy2YsbfKEL6KG5xwox23DYgQpjunH3
transaction
e53d59c6f194e306dfb55bbbe97e14335829e6281b9b343e10ad8665c22f582b
spent
true